William, from a fire department in VA, I can tell you that lots of folks are praying for the colleagues, friends, and families of those that died.
Just now I was reading a summary of events that our safety officer sent out. It looks like it started as a "simple" (my word, not theirs) trash fire outside the store. It just reinforces that no fire is simple.
It's a terrible irony that this week the fire service across the nation is observing a week long "Fire and EMS Safety Stand Down," where participating departments suspend all nonessential non-emergency activities to focus entirely on safety.
